Metal cladding replacement is a service that involves removing old or damaged metal panels from a building’s exterior and installing new, durable cladding in their place. This process helps improve the appearance of a property while also enhancing its protection against weather elements such as rain, wind, and sun. The replacement typically includes assessing the existing cladding, carefully removing worn or corroded panels, and securely attaching new panels that match the building’s style and specifications. Skilled contractors ensure that the new cladding is properly sealed and fitted to prevent leaks and extend the lifespan of the exterior.

This service is often needed when metal panels have become compromised over time. Common problems include rust, corrosion, dents, warping, or fading that diminish the building’s visual appeal and structural integrity. In some cases, damage may be caused by severe weather or accidental impacts. Replacing the metal cladding can address these issues effectively, preventing further deterioration and potential interior damage. It also serves as a proactive measure to maintain the property's value and curb appeal, especially in areas prone to harsh weather conditions.

Properties that typically benefit from metal cladding replacement include commercial buildings, warehouses, industrial facilities, and residential homes with metal exteriors. These structures often use metal cladding for its durability and low maintenance, but over time, exposure to the elements can lead to wear and tear. Replacement is especially relevant for buildings that are several decades old or have existing panels showing signs of rust, corrosion, or structural damage. By updating the cladding, property owners can restore the building’s appearance and ensure it remains protected for years to come.

The overview below groups typical Metal Cladding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Meridian, ID.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or metal cladding repairs in Meridian range from $250 to $600, covering small sections or localized issues.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material type.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of metal cladding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for many local projects.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push beyond this range, especially if matching existing materials is required.

Full Cladding Replacement - Complete replacement of metal cladding often falls between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the building size and material choices. Most full projects land in the middle of this spectrum, with higher costs for larger or intricate designs.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ive or custom metal cladding replacements can exceed $20,000 in some cases, particularly for large commercial buildings or highly detailed work. Fewer projects reach into this highest tier, which involves more labor and specialized mater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is metal cladding replacement? Metal cladding replacement involves removing old or damaged metal siding and installing new panels to improve the appearance and protection of a building's exterior.

Why should I consider replacing my metal cladding? Replacing metal cladding can enhance curb appeal, address damage or deterioration, and improve the building's overall durability and weather resistance.

What types of metal materials are used for cladding replacement? Common materials include aluminum, steel, copper, and zinc, each offering different aesthetic and functional benefits for exterior siding.
